Is there Ornstein-Zernike equation in the canonical ensemble?

Abstract

A general density-functional formalism using an extended variable-space is presented for classical fluids in the canonical ensemble (CE). An exact equation is derived that plays the role of the Ornstein-Zernike (OZ) equation in the grand canonical ensemble (GCE). When applied to the ideal gas we obtain the exact result for the total correlation function hN. For a homogeneous fluid with N particles the new equation only differs from OZ by 1/N and it allows to obtain an approximate expression for hN in terms of its GCE counterpart that agrees with the expansion of hN in powers of 1/N.
